Key Features
- Suitable for Nema 17, Nema 23 and Nema34 Stepper Motor,2-phase hybrid stepper motors(Outer diameter: 42,57,86mm).
- Suitable for drive Two-phase stepping motor dynamic voltage 20V to 50V, the maximum drive current is less than 5.6A.
- The maximum drive subdivision is 128, more accurate.
- Suitable for any small-and-medium automatic equipment with CNC controller, such as X-Y-Z tables, labeling machines, laser cutters, engraving machines, and pick-place devices.
